Have you seen an original rock opera of late? Well, this one is original, feminine/ist and local! Gilli Moon, local rock star and founder of Warrior Girl Music and Jayne DeMente, past film producer turned feminist and activist, have written a very humorous and poignant rock opera to benefit their grant projects.

This musical features an odd cast of Goddesses, meeting for their millennium convention, that will pick and train a new archetype for the next 100 years; one who can bring compassion to contemporary societies’ difficulties. A young woman, recently deceased, embodies the female aspect of Kwan Yin, Tara and the female lineage of the Lord Matreia. The cast is a combination of cross cultured dieties, each with interesting personalities, ranging from a Diva to Angels in Lingerie. This Opera features not only an original script and but a new music libretto. If you like rock music women, this is a piece not to be missed!

.Jayne DeMente is a native Angelian and a graduate of the California Institute of Integral Studies, with a Masters in Women's Spirituality. Gilli Moon, accomplished artist with her 4th CD, hails from "down under" and is a polymedia artist, music recording artist, actress, author, visual artist and entrepreneur. She has also founded the international non profit organization "Songsalive".
